Fine tuning

After getting feedback I added in a funnel at the top to act as a reservoir for the water and sealed it with electrical tape. The hosing kept curling which was unexpected and was able to solve the problem by strapping them down with cable ties on to the mounting board (as well as the hosing valves). I got feedback from Luke that I should paint the board that the piece is going to be mounted on. White would complement the colours of the water and would be the colour to pull the least amount of attention away from the piece.
I wanted to find out how I was going to hang my piece for exhibition, so I asked John the technician and he directed me to Chris on first floor. He told me the best way was if he hooked up chains and I drilled some holes into my mount, so that my piece would be suspended, much like the hanging walls for exhibitions.
